
Blank control (Black line): Mouse blood (Black)._x000D_ Primary Antibody (green line): PTGER1 Polyclonal Antibody (bs-6316R)_x000D_ Dilution: 3μg /10^6 cells;_x000D_ Isotype Control Antibody (orange line): Rabbit IgG ._x000D_ Secondary Antibody (white blue line): Goat anti-rabbit IgG_x000D_ Dilution: 1μg /test._x000D_ Protocol_x000D_ The cells were fixed with 4% PFA (10min at room temperature)and then were incubated in 5%BSA to block non-specific protein-protein interactions for 30 min at room temperature. Cells stained with Primary Antibody for 30 min at room temperature. The secondary antibody used for 40 min at room temperature. Acquisition of 20,000 events was performed.
